The future of football development in India is an evolving topic attracting attention from academies, coaches, parents, and young players alike. Many wonder how grassroots football will progress in the next five years, especially given India’s growing football popularity alongside challenges like limited infrastructure and uneven coaching quality. This article sheds light on key trends shaping Indian grassroots football, and what practical developments we can expect that serve long-term player growth.

What is the current state of grassroots football in India?

Grassroots football in India refers to the organized football activities at youth and amateur levels, especially those focusing on skill development and player fundamentals before professional pathways. Efforts include local academy programs, school competitions, and community coaching camps.

Currently, Indian grassroots football presents a mixed picture: while participation numbers are rising, structured development systems vary widely from region to region. Coaching practices and infrastructure remain inconsistent, limiting reliable progression pathways for talented youth.

Key Indian grassroots football trends influencing the future

Several trends are driving change in Indian youth football. These include the rapid growth of football academies tailored to development, integration of technology for performance tracking, and increasing engagement from private clubs and international partnerships. Parents and coaches also show growing commitment to long-term training and disciplined player habits.

Furthermore, the increased visibility of Indian football on global platforms is inspiring young players and attracting investment. These trends collectively build a foundation for improving player development pathways and raising coaching standards over the next five years.

How to improve youth football development in India effectively

Improving youth football demands a structured approach combining quality coaching, infrastructure, and player monitoring. Clubs and academies should adopt progressive training systems focused on skill repetition, decision-making, and mental resilience rather than early results.

Coaches benefit from continuous education about modern training techniques and use of technology to assess player performance reliably. Meanwhile, parents play a crucial role by supporting consistent attendance, recovery habits, and encouraging mindset growth, understanding development takes time.

Understanding the football coaching evolution in India

The evolution of football coaching in India shows a shift from informal training to organized, methodical programs. Coaches increasingly focus on development-first principles, emphasizing player-centered learning rather than rigid tactics.

Innovations like video analysis, individualized feedback, and AI-driven assessments are beginning to influence coaching methodologies, especially in better-funded academies. This evolution improves the quality and consistency of training delivered to young players.

Practical implementation for grassroots clubs

Grassroots clubs should focus on creating clear player development pathways grounded in structured training environments. This means establishing consistent training schedules, incorporating multidisciplinary recovery practices, and using performance tracking to tailor individual growth.

Leveraging technology for football performance analysis and adopting organized academy workflows can streamline talent identification and enhance long-term player visibility. Involving parents in this structured environment strengthens the support system around the player.

Common development mistakes holding Indian football back

A frequent mistake is prioritizing short-term match results over long-term player growth. This can lead to neglecting fundamental skills, mental development, and physical conditioning. Uneven coaching qualifications and inconsistent training intensity also disrupt progression.

Overlooking recovery and player wellness, and ignoring structured feedback mechanisms weaken development pathways. Addressing these errors requires a collective commitment to patience, education, and implementing proven development frameworks.

Future football infrastructure in India: What to expect

Investment in football facilities is gradually increasing, with dedicated training centers being developed by private clubs and local associations. Over the next five years, expect improved pitch quality, specialized gyms, and medical support tailored for youth players.

Enhanced infrastructure supports safe, year-round training and aids in professionalizing academy environments. This infrastructure growth is crucial for meeting the physical and technical demands of modern football development in India.

Conclusion

The future of football development in India rests on continued evolution in grassroots training, infrastructure, coaching, and technology adoption. Success will depend on unified efforts from academies, coaches, parents, and governing bodies to prioritize structured, long-term player development over immediate results. Embracing disciplined training habits, modern coaching methodologies, and effective player tracking will shape more confident, skilled footballers prepared for higher levels. This measured progress promises a sustainable rise in Indian football quality and popularity, fostering a healthier ecosystem for young players to thrive.

What is grassroots football development in India?

It refers to organized football activities focused on youth skill growth and foundations before professional levels.

Q

How to improve football skills for young players in India?

Consistent training emphasizing fundamentals, decision-making, and mental growth, supported by quality coaching, is key.

Q

Why do some young players struggle to improve in India?

Inconsistent coaching, lack of structured training, and insufficient recovery practices often hinder steady progress.

Q

How to train youth footballers effectively at grassroots level?

Use structured training systems focusing on repetition, feedback, and tailored progression paths suited to player needs.

Q

Best age to start formal football training in India?

Around 8-10 years old is ideal for starting structured training, allowing gradual skill and physical development.

Q

How long does it take to see progress in youth football development?

Meaningful improvement often takes several years of consistent, disciplined training and proper guidance.
